What's The Definition Of Seeded?
[adj] sprinkled with seed; "a seeded lawn"
[adj] (of the more skilled contestants) selectively arranged in the draw for position a tournament so that they meet each other in later rounds [adj] having or supplied with seeds; "a seeded breadfruit"; "seeded rolls" [adj] (combining form) having seeds as specified; "many-seeded"; "black-seeded" [adj] having the seeds extracted; "seeded raisins" Synonyms | Synonyms for Seeded: planted | seedless | seedy | sown Related Terms | Find terms related to Seeded: See Also | |
